Entering the vibrant African market holds immense potential, but navigating its complex regulatory landscape can be a daunting challenge. To successfully enter your business in Africa, consider leveraging the expertise of an Employer of Record (EOR) service.

An EOR acts as a legal sponsor for your overseas employees, handling all aspects of compliance, including payroll, benefits, and statutory obligations. This frees up your valuable time to focus on core business activities. By partnering with an EOR, you can efficiently scale your workforce in Africa while minimizing liability.

  • Additionally, EORs provide invaluable expertise into local labor laws and cultural nuances, ensuring a smooth and successful adaptation for your employees.
  • Therefore, an EOR can be your strategic ally in unlocking the vast rewards of African expansion.

Navigating Your African Workforce: Simplifying International Payroll and HR

Venturing into the dynamic African market presents significant opportunities for businesses. However, navigating the complexities of international payroll and HR can quickly become a complex task. This is where an Africa Employer of Record (EOR) emerges as a strategic solution, streamlining your operations and allowing you to concentrate on core business objectives. An EOR acts as the legal employer for your staff in Africa, handling all aspects of payroll, benefits administration, compliance with local labor laws, and more.

By partnering with an experienced EOR, you can mitigate the risks associated with international expansion while utilizing the talent pool in Africa. Their/Its/They expertise ensures accurate and timely payroll processing, minimizes administrative burdens, and enables a smooth onboarding experience for your new employees.
